WebI-Bonds can also be purchased at tax time with your federal income tax refund. This allows you to purchase up to $5k more per year (for a total of $15k per year). A couple filing a joint tax return can buy up to $25k a year — $10k each, plus an extra $5k at tax time. WebMar 14, 2024 · 1 attorney answer. Posted on Mar 14, 2024.
